#2e2e98 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2e2e98 is composed of 18% red, 18%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.7% cyan, 69.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 240 degrees, a saturation of 53.5% and a lightness of 38.8%. #2e2e98 color hex could be obtained by blending #5c5cff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

Shades and Tints of #2e2e98

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000001 is the darkest color, while #f1f1f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#2e2e98

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5c5c6a is the less saturated color, while #0000c6 is the most saturated one.
